Teatro alla Scala, the call for proposals for new laboratories is underway

by admin

It is called «La Magnifica Fabbrica» and it is the tender that will allow the creation, within five years, of the new laboratories and warehouses of the Teatro alla Scala in Milan in the Rubattino district. To promote it, the Municipality of Milan and the Teatro alla Scala Foundation, with the aim of bringing together laboratories and warehouses in one place. «They will be modern and of excellent quality and then with the mayor we want to include this city in the city – explained the superintendent of the theater, Dominique Meyer – so it will be accessible, there will be a room with 600 seats and there will be open rehearsals. We do not want to close the Scala inside four walls, but to open it to the city. I hope it will be ready as soon as possible, but it is a great operation ».

The competition will end in May 2022, the first phase will end in January with the choice of the seven best projects and in May there will be the winner. “This project – adds the mayor of Milan Giuseppe Sala, who is also president of the Foundation – is combined with the administration’s policies on sustainability, there will be a different handling of goods”.

The total investment for the construction of the new laboratories and warehouses of the La Scala theater, in the former industrial area where the Innocenti was located in the Rubattino district, is 120 million euros, of which 98 for the part relating to the laboratories and deposits of La Scala. and 22 for the extension of the Lambretta park.

The “Magnifica Fabbrica” ​​della Scala will have workshops dedicated to scenography, mechanics, carpentry, tailoring, the creation of costumes, more than 70 thousand people own the theater. “An important treasure,” according to superintendent Dominique Meyer. Thanks to the new computerized repositories, you will always know where each piece is. There will be several rehearsal rooms, two for the choir, a large rehearsal room for the orchestra, which will be added to the Palazzina Verdi being built behind the Piermrini, which will cover 70% of the rehearsals, but is limited in size.

There will also be a 3,700 square meter complex of rehearsal rooms for direction, equivalent to three stages, a multipurpose space with 600 seats open to the city. The warehouses will be modern and computerized, with 2,500 containers in which to keep, adds Meyer, “70 productions in order, according to a conservation system that will be compatible with the needs of large international theaters, given that we also do many co-productions”.
